HomeMy WebLinkAbout66-35 CITY OF UK!AH RESOLUTION NO. 66-35 RESOLUTION AMENDING RESOLUTION NO. 66-32 ADOPTED FEBRUARY 16, 19~6 B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of the City of Uklah, that Section 5.05 (b) of Resolution No. 66-32 adopted February 16, 1966 is amended to read as follows: (b) Parkin.~ District No. 1 Reserve Fund. The Treasurer shall set aside out of the Revenue Fund and and shall deposit in the Parking District No. 1 Re- serve Fund (the initial payment of $15,000 into which Fund is provided for in paragraph (b) of Section 3.03 hereof) on or before the sixth business day of each month, all moneys in the Revenue Fund that shall be required to maintain the Parking District No. 1 Re- serve Fund in the amount of $15,000 until April 1, lq6?. Thereafter the Treasurer shall set aside out of the Revenue Fund and shall deposit in the Parking District No. 1 Reserve Fund, on or before the sixth business day of each month, beginning not later than the month of April, 1967, the sum of $8.~.33 (herein defined as an "incremental deposit"), plus such addi- tional sum, if any, necessary to maintain said Reserve Fund in the amount of $15,000 plus all incremental deposits made therein, until there shall have been accumulated, in said Reserve Fund by April 1, 1969 the amount of $17,000. Thereafter, the Treasurer shall set aside out of the Revenue Fund and shall deposit in the Parking District No. 1 Reserve Fund, on or before the sixth business day of each month, begin- ning not later than the month of April, 1969, all moneys in the Revenue Fund that shall be required to maintain the Parking District No. 1 Reserve Fund in the amount of $17,000 so long as any Bonds are out- standing; provided that if any Additional Bonds are issued hereunder the minimum amount to be maintained in said Reserve Fund shall be the amount then equal to the maximum annual debt service on all of the Bonds and Additional Bonds issued hereunder and then outstanding. No payment need be made into the Park- inR District No. 1 Reserve Fund so long as there shall be in said fund a sum at least equal to said required amount. Ali. moneys in the Parking District No. 1 Reserve Fund shall be used and withdrawn solely for the purpose of paying the principal of and inter- est on the Bonds, or any part thereof, in the event that no other funds of the City are then available therefor.
